Armchair tourism: Exploring individuals’ innovative travel experience in the with-corona era
Tourism Management ( IF 12.7 ) Pub Date : 2022-06-10 , DOI: 10.1016/j.tourman.2022.104582
Hyoungeun Moon , Yu Jongsik , Bee-Lia Chua , Heesup Han

This study investigates the experiential components of armchair travelling and their effect on the armchair travelers’ responses, which include perceived authenticity, destination image, and behavioral intention, by using a mixed-method approach. A total of 414 survey responses collected through an online research panel were analyzed by conducting a confirmatory factor analysis and structural equation modeling. The analysis reveals that a sense of telepresence and copresence are the major factors, which generate authenticity and a positive destination image. Perceived ease of use influences building a favorable destination image, whereas self-other online interactions significantly create a sense of authenticity with the armchair travel experience. The content analysis for the qualitative data collected using an open-ended question shows that the armchair travelers gain vicarious travel experiences and resolve mental stress through armchair travelling. Based on the results, this study provides meaningful theoretical and practical implications to the armchair tourism literature and industry.

扶手椅旅游:探索新冠时代个人的创新旅游体验

本研究采用混合方法研究扶手椅旅行的体验成分及其对扶手椅旅行者反应的影响,包括感知真实性、目的地形象和行为意图。通过进行验证性因素分析和结构方程建模,分析了通过在线研究小组收集的总共 414 份调查回复。分析表明,远程临场感和共同临场感是产生真实性和积极的目的地形象的主要因素。感知易用性会影响建立良好的目的地形象,而自我其他在线互动则通过扶手椅旅行体验显着营造真实感。使用开放式问题收集的定性数据的内容分析表明,扶手椅旅行者获得了替代旅行体验并通过扶手椅旅行解决了精神压力。基于这些结果,本研究为扶手椅旅游文献和行业提供了有意义的理论和实践意义。
